1. Install "ruby-slim" package

Here is a brief guide to show you how to install ruby-slim on Ubuntu 18.04 LTS (Bionic Beaver)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install ruby-slim

2. Uninstall "ruby-slim" package

Please follow the steps below to uninstall ruby-slim on Ubuntu 18.04 LTS (Bionic Beaver):

$ sudo apt remove ruby-slim $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
